찾다

 >  Q&A  >  본문

java - 중복되지 않는 목록 컬렉션을 구성합니다. 이 코드에 어떤 문제가 있나요?

구현되기를 희망하는 기능은 List提供一个原子操作:若没有则添加。因为ArrayList本身不是线程安全的,所以通过集合Collections.synchronizedList将其转换为一个线程安全的类,然后通过一个辅助的方法来为List에 대해 이러한 기능을 달성하는 것입니다.

으아악

이 코드는 스레드에 안전하지 않나요? 그렇다면 증명할 수 있나요? 감사합니다

高洛峰高洛峰2727일 전1130

모든 응답(2)나는 대답할 것이다

  • 伊谢尔伦

    伊谢尔伦2017-06-12 09:27:37

    그냥 ConcurrentSkipListSet만 사용해도 괜찮습니다

    회신하다
    0
  • 漂亮男人

    漂亮男人2017-06-12 09:27:37

    반복되지 않는 목록은 단지 집합일 뿐이죠? , 원자가 필요합니다. 스레드로부터 안전한 세트가 아닌가요?

    회신하다
    0
  • 취소회신하다